Submit your Research - Make it Global NewsExploring the Nutritional Profile of Seaweed Chips
Seaweed chips, often made from varieties like nori or ulva, represent a shift toward nutrient-dense alternatives in the snack aisle. These crispy treats derive from edible macroalgae harvested from oceans worldwide, processed through drying, seasoning, and roasting to achieve their signature crunch. Unlike traditional potato chips, which are typically high in unhealthy fats and empty calories, seaweed chips offer a low-calorie option packed with essential nutrients absorbed directly from seawater.
A typical 5-gram serving of seaweed chips provides around 80 micrograms of iodine, alongside fiber, vitamins, and minerals, making them appealing for those seeking functional foods. Harvard researchers note that seaweed's high water and fiber content keeps calories minimal while delivering umami flavor from glutamic acid.
University-Led Innovations in Seaweed Processing
Academic institutions are at the forefront of transforming raw seaweed into consumer-ready chips. At Universitas Islam Negeri Maulana Malik Ibrahim Malang in Indonesia, researchers developed an innovative processing method involving cleaning, drying, soaking, and frying seaweed to create chips that retain high antioxidant levels and appeal to local markets.
Similarly, the University of Sri Jayewardenepura in Sri Lanka engineered a snack from Ulva fasciata seaweed, incorporating ginger oleoresin at 200 ppm to mask fishy notes and enhance sensory appeal. Their product boasted 19.18% protein, 44.64% fiber, and high minerals like calcium (13,700 ppm) and iron (885 ppm), scoring top marks in taste and texture tests.
Health Benefits Supported by Scientific Studies
Seaweed chips contribute to gut health through polysaccharides like fucoidans and alginates, which gut bacteria ferment into short-chain fatty acids. These support beneficial microbes, immunity, and pathogen resistance.
- Cardiovascular protection: A Japanese prospective study linked regular seaweed consumption to lower cardiovascular disease risk and mortality.
72 - Antioxidant effects: Polyphenols and carotenoids combat oxidative stress, potentially lowering cholesterol and glucose levels.
- Mineral boost: High in iodine for thyroid function, iron for anemia prevention, and omega-3s as a vegan DHA source.
In Indonesia, Kurnia Jaya Persada Institute analyzed chips with 39.97 μg/g iron and 67.1% vitamin C in spicy variants, aiding iron absorption to combat adolescent anemia.

Navigating Risks and Safety Considerations
While beneficial, seaweed chips warrant moderation due to iodine accumulation—up to 232 mcg in 10g dried nori, nearing daily limits. Excessive intake risks thyroid disruption, especially for sensitive groups.
University guidelines emphasize sourcing from clean waters and checking labels for sodium, as processing can elevate it. Harvard advises balancing intake within diverse diets.
Brunel University's Insights on Consumer Adoption
Brunel University London's 2025 study surveyed UK and Japanese consumers, revealing cultural unfamiliarity as the top barrier in the West. In the UK, seaweed appeals more to ethnic minorities and graduates, while risk-tolerant eaters are early adopters. Led by Prof. Steven David Pickering, findings urge tailored marketing to integrate seaweed snacks culturally.Brunel University study
"Familiarity is a major barrier," Pickering noted, advocating behavioral science alongside nutrition research.
Global Market Trends and Sustainability
The seaweed snacks market, valued at $2.43 billion in 2024, is projected to reach $4.66 billion by 2030, driven by health trends in North America and Europe.
Seaweed farming requires no freshwater or fertilizers, aiding climate goals and reducing reliance on land crops.
